  • Where do I collect keys from?

    Check-in and key pick-up for your Vintage Holiday House is located on Vintage Drive, next door to Mezze and above Nineteen.

    When you enter The Vintage Estate, follow the road for approximately 1km until you come to a roundabout, head straight through and turn right into the carpark. Our reception space is shared with Peppers Hunter Valley.

  • Can I have an early check-in/late check-out?

    Check-in is guaranteed from 2:00pm and check out is at 10:00am. We can advise closer to the check-in date if other times are available for check-in/out, depending on other bookings and scheduled cleaning. If you would like to contact us a few days before your arrival, we will be able to confirm a time for you.

  • Do I need to make a deposit?

    Yes. 50% of the total tariff is due within 48hrs of making your booking. If no payment is received then the booking will be cancelled.

  • When is the final payment due?

    The final payment is due 14 days prior to your arrival date. Payments will not be accepted on arrival.

  • What do I need to bring?

    All linen and cutlery/crockery/cooking equipment is provided at your holiday house. You will need to bring your own food and items such as cooking oil, condiments, foil, cling wrap. As the houses are all individually owned, they may have some of these items but others may not, so it is best to bring it with you to be sure your stay is as smooth as possible. Similarly, some owners may have a coffee pod machine and supply a start up selection for you and others may just have the machine for you to bring your own pods. Some houses may not even have a coffee machine, so they will have sachets of instant coffee for you. If you need to know if a house has a specific item, please contact us directly.

  • Is there a shuttle bus?

    The Vintage does not have its own shuttle bus, however there are several companies that you can pay to use to get around the vineyards and local area. Some of these include The Hunter Hopper which is a hop on/hop off bus that has designated stops/times to several popular local attractions and wineries. Vineyard Shuttles is a private company that you can hire for wine tours or transfers. There are also taxi cabs available that are located at Cessnock (approx. 15 mins away).   • Are pets allowed at the houses?

    We do have a limited number of pet friendly properties available which will allow for up to 2 dogs to be kept outside at an additional cost. To ensure the properties are maintained to the highest standard, please note that dogs are NOT allowed inside the house (unless it is stated in the property description) and must be confined within the fenced areas provided at the property. Additional cleaning costs will be incurred for failure to adhere to these rules or any damage done to the property. Due to Council restrictions, cats and birds are not permitted within The Vintage.
